Moroccan raspberry exports reach historic record in 2024/2025

Moroccan raspberry exports have reached an unprecedented level in the 2024/2025 season, with a 14% increase in volume compared to the previous season and a 9% rise compared to the previous record in 2022/2023, according to EastFruit. April 2025 marked a peak with over 10,000 tons exported, confirming......

Morocco records 32 million livestock in census amid drought recovery efforts

Morocco’s Ministry of Agriculture has announced the results of the national livestock census conducted between June 26 and August 11, which recorded a total of 32,832,573 heads of livestock. The census aims to provide an updated database to boost productivity and support food sovereignty amidst......
